What are the different types of valuation?
There are three principal types of valuation: • A standard/basic valuation: just that, a basic assessment of the property. This will not be a detailed examination and is principally to satisfy the lender that the property is suitable security for a mortgage. It is important to stress that this option is primarily for the lenders benefit and while the lender will confirm to you whether the property has been valued satisfactorily, i.e. at the amount you have agreed to pay, most of them will not provide you with any further detail about the property. • A Home Buyer’s Report: this is based on a more detailed inspection of the property and is designed to highlight key features of the property and indicate any faults, so that the purchaser can take an informed decision on whether to proceed with the purchase or whether to amend his offer accordingly.
